Flamengo competes in the 22nd round of the Brasileirão against Grêmio


Flamengo returns to the field this Sunday (31) when they face Grêmio, in a match valid for the 22nd round of the Brazilian Championship. Thus, for the duel that starts at 4pm (Brasília time), coach Filipe Luís has set the starting team with De La Cruz in place of Jorginho.

Who are Flamengo's absentees?

To face Grêmio, Flamengo has three confirmed absentees. This is because, Erick Pulgar is still recovering from foot surgery. In addition to the midfielder, full-back Alex Sandro is treating a calf injury. Finally, Jorginho is also in the Medical Department due to pain in the posterior muscle of the left thigh.

Is Flamengo the leader of the Brasileirão?

Currently, Flamengo under Filipe Luís is on a roll in the Brasileirão. Not surprisingly, the Rubro-Negro is in first place in the standings, with 46 points earned so far. Moreover, Fla has the best attack and defense of the competition, with 44 goals scored and only nine conceded.
